Hinges are mechanical devices used to connect two solid objects and allow them to rotate relative to each other. Hinges can be made of movable parts.The components are made of foldable materials. Hinges are mainly installed on doors and windows, while hinges are more commonly installed on cabinets. To provide a better experience for users, hydraulic hinges (also known as dampers) have emerged, which feature a feature that allows the cabinet door to slow down smoothly when opened or closed.The buffer function when closing reduces the noise generated by the cabinet door colliding with the cabinet body to a great extent.
